CLASS II-III 7.8 miles
The Oregon 211 to Redland Road stretch of Clear Creek in Clackamas County is 7.8 miles long and is according to American Whitewater a class II-III section of whitewater. Briefly about the general area: All the water falling down from the sky makes Clear Creek a wet place; the month of December is the wettest with most of the rain
while July is mostly the driest month. During the warmest time of the year at Clear Creek temperatures are commonly in the 80's. Once the sun is down it plunges down to the 50's. Daytime highs all through the wintertime are in the 40's, and all through the dark hours in the winter at Clear Creek temperatures descend to the 30's.
